Specialist fabricator and installer of engineered stone worktops Roann has become a member of the Worktop Fabricators Federation (WFF).
The WFF, a non-profit trade association founded in 2020, promotes professionalism and collaboration across the worktop fabrication and stone masonry industries.
Through networking, shared resources, and industry forums, WFF members work together to uphold best practices in health and safety, factory standards, and the use of high-quality equipment.

With over 100 members, the WFF fosters knowledge-sharing and investment in training, processes, and technology.
Established three decades ago in Wakefield, Roann has a £12million turnover and fabricates over 15,000 worktops per year from its purpose-built factory.
Counting Taylor Wimpey, Berkeley PLC, Vistry Partnerships and David Wilson Homes among its customers, the company also templates, manufactures, and installs worktops directly to homeowners through Roann at Home.
Roann is accredited by ConstructionLine Gold, SafeContractor, SMAS Worksafe, and is a member of CQMS and Safety Schemes in Procurement (SSIP) Scheme, reinforcing its commitment to health and safety within the UK construction sector.
